If it's a 2000 model, repace the basket with a billet basket. It wont help performance but will stop losing an engine!
We found that over 180hp we started to crack baskets on the 2000 model. Post that will handle a few more ponies but would still recommned a billet basket to protect from drama.
Muzzys sell a performance kit which has three strong springs. I would recommend that and their basket.
Use standard fibres and 2mm steels. Keep an eye on stack hieght.

the 01 basket is the same as the 00. 02 + are a bit stronger, but not as strong as billet
you wont need a lock up with the 3 stiff springs unless you get really serious

slip it for a long duration of time trying to prevent a wheelie while holding it WFO
the muzzy kit puts you into the low range of stack height spec. just add the correct amount of steels (you can stack steels back to back) to bring it to the high end of the spec so it lasts even longer. example, take out a 2mm steel and replace it with two 1.6s. adds 1.2mm to stack height....

then put in a stock clutch pack, and a lock up, tune it, and be done..........
I have had stock clutches go over 900 passes........., and half of them in the 1.3s in 60 ft.
The thick steels are a good thing at times, as your stack height must be correct, but the stock fibers will last a long time.........
